Binary search geeksforgeeks solution

WebMar 30, 2024 · Diameter of Binary Tree ( Solution) Check for Balanced Tree ( Solution) n’th node from end of linked list ( Solution) Left View of Binary Tree ( Solution) Merge two sorted linked lists ( Solution) Queue using two Stacks ( Solution) Stack using two queues ( Solution) Level order traversal in spiral form ( Solution) WebProgramming Problems grouped by Company & Topic Tags Practice GeeksforGeeks. Data Structures. Data Structures [1698] Arrays [651] Strings [393] Tree [181] Hash [146] Matrix [111] Graph [103]

Python Program for Binary Search (Recursive and Iterative)

WebBinary Search. Basic Accuracy: 44.32% Submissions: 342K+ Points: 1. Given a sorted array of size N and an integer K, find the position (0-based indexing) at which K is … WebFeb 16, 2024 · Binary Search is a searching algorithm used in a sorted array by repeatedly dividing the search interval in half. The idea of binary search is to use the information … importance of maori myths and legends https://grorion.com

Binary Search in Java - GeeksforGeeks

WebPlatform to practice programming problems. Solve company interview questions and improve your coding intellect WebA page for Binary Search Tree Data structure with detailed definition of binary search tree, its representation and standard problems on binary search tree. WebFeb 8, 2024 · Binary Search Tree (BST) is a special binary tree that has the properties: The left subtree contains only the keys which are lesser than the key of the node. The … importance of manufacturing engineers

geeksforgeeks-solutions · GitHub Topics · GitHub

Category:Count permutations of given array that generates the same Binary Search ...

Tags:Binary search geeksforgeeks solution

Binary search geeksforgeeks solution

Count permutations of given array that generates the same Binary Search ...

WebBinary search is the most popular Search algorithm.It is efficient and also one of the most commonly used techniques that is used to solve problems. If all the names in the world are written down together in order and you want to search for the position of a specific name, binary search will accomplish this in a maximum of 35 iterations. WebApr 13, 2024 · 0:00 / 25:26 Partition the Array GFG POTD 13th April 2024 Binary Search Java C++ Problem Of The Day Prativa TECH 422 subscribers Subscribe No views 54 seconds ago The …

Binary search geeksforgeeks solution

Did you know?

WebJul 11, 2024 · def binary_search (arr, x): low = 0 high = len(arr) - 1 mid = 0 while low <= high: mid = (high + low) // 2 if arr [mid] < x: low = mid + 1 elif arr [mid] > x: high = mid - 1 …

WebFeb 9, 2024 · Binary search is one of the searching techniques applied when the input is sorted as here we are focusing on finding the middle element that acts as a reference … WebApr 6, 2024 · algorithms data-structures dynamic-programming codechef-solutions google-kickstart geeksforgeeks-cpp binary-search-website Updated on Feb 6, 2024 C++ tridibsamanta / GeeksforGeeks_Solutions Star 4 Code Issues Pull requests My solution to some problems listed on GeeksforGeeks

WebGiven a binary tree, find its preorder traversal. Example 1: Input: 1 / 4 / \ 4 & Problems Courses Get Hired; Contests. GFG Weekly Coding Contest. Job-a-Thon: Hiring Challenge. BiWizard School Contest. Gate CS Scholarship Test. Solving for India Hack-a-thon. All Contest and Events. POTD ... WebMar 27, 2024 · Eggs dropping puzzle (Binomial Coefficient and Binary Search Solution) Given n eggs and k floors, find the minimum number of trials needed in worst case to …

WebGiven an array A[] which represents a Complete Binary Tree i.e, if index i is the parent, index 2*i + 1 is the left child and index 2*i + 2 is the right child. The task is to find the …

WebA BST is defined as follows: The left subtree of a node contains only nodes with keys less than the node's key. The right subtree of a node contains only nodes with keys greater than the node's key. Both the left and right subtrees must also … literary agents in new jerseyWebFeb 16, 2024 · Binary Search is a searching algorithm used in a sorted array by repeatedly dividing the search interval in half. The idea of binary search is to use the information that the array is sorted and reduce the time complexity to O (Log n). Binary Search Algorithm: The basic steps to perform Binary Search are: Sort the array in ascending order. importance of map studyWebBinary Search Practice GeeksforGeeks. Given a sorted array of size N and an integer K, find the position at which K is present in the array using binary search. Example … importance of map reading skillsWebFeb 7, 2024 · Binary Search is a searching algorithm for finding an element's position in a sorted array. In this approach, the element is always searched in the middle of the array. … literary agents in oklahomaWebGeeksforGeeks holds the right to disqualify any participant at any stage of the process if the participant is deemed to be acting fraudulently or otherwise. In case of any dispute over rankings and leaderboard, the decision of GeeksforGeeks shall be final. Interview shortlisting will be done by specific companies based on their own criteria. literary agents in nmWebJul 11, 2024 · def binary_search (arr, x): low = 0 high = len(arr) - 1 mid = 0 while low <= high: mid = (high + low) // 2 if arr [mid] < x: low = mid + 1 elif arr [mid] > x: high = mid - 1 else: return mid return -1 arr = [ 2, 3, 4, 10, 40 ] x = 10 result = binary_search (arr, x) if result != -1: print("Element is present at index", str(result)) else: importance of map reading in militaryWebFeb 25, 2024 · Binary search is an efficient algorithm for finding an element within a sorted array. The time complexity of the binary search is O (log n). One of the main drawbacks … Complexity Analysis of Linear Search: Time Complexity: Best Case: In the best case, … What is Binary Search Tree? Binary Search Tree is a node-based binary tree data … Geek wants to scan N documents using two scanners. If S1 and S2 are the time … importance of marble rock